Output d1e896893fac12faa969dd56c752a9c3f5969392f726d21b5629c04ecc88b87f:6

value
51290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c4dbcdc01618907c3102931457c534ce677a33e OP_EQUAL
address
3LKGtzLqNVR98i9SY759fgwzwDXD5HjHZP
transaction
d1e896893fac12faa969dd56c752a9c3f5969392f726d21b5629c04ecc88b87f
confirmations
77472
spent
true